FLATPACK

The Flatpack cage protects AQDSU canister, SSH-01 hydrophone cylinder and cable takeout.
Material Flatpack cage aluminum-bronze
articulated bend restrictors glass-fiber-reinforced plastic
Maximum outside width 174 mm
Maximum outside height 71 mm
Cage length 455 mm
Number of bend restrictors 7 + 1 tapered end link on each side
Overall length with bend restrictors 968 mm
Stiff length 392 mm
Weight in air 14.15 kg
Weight in sea water 10.88 kg

ENVIRONMENT
Storage temperature – 40ºC to + 60ºC
Operating temperature 0°C to +40°C
Deployment/Testing Temperature* 15ºC to + 40ºC
(with degraded performance)
Maximum operating depth SeaRay® 100 100m
Maximum operating depth SeaRay® 300 300m
500m with specific handling care

AQAS/EXTENDERS
Extender cables are constructed of varying lengths of lightweight, flexible SeaRay® bulk cable, from 25 metres to 400 metres long. They have a
SeaRay® female cable connector (28-contact circular socket connector) housed in a waterproof cable termination at each end.
Optical extender cables are constructed of varying lengths of armored cable from 400 metres to 2,4 kilometers long. They have a SeaRay® female
cable connector (28-contact circular socket connector) housed in a waterproof cable termination at each end. The termination includes the
optical/electrical converters.
The AcQuisition Active Section (AQAS) is the data-gathering section with flatpacks spaced equidistantly along the cable. The quantity of flatpacks
on an AQAS must be even.
User-specified distances between flatpacks are between 12.5 metres and 55 metres. Standard AQAS configuration is 10 flatpacks per cable.
Typical lengths are 250 metres and 500 metres. For example, an AQAS with ten flatpacks 25 metres apart will have a length of 250 metres. An
AQAS with ten flatpacks 50 metres apart will have a length of 500 metres.
Minimum spacing of receiver points 12.5 m
Maximum spacing of receiver points up to 60 m

* Tests can be run before deployment on the seabed.


SeaRay® 100
Color yellow
Outside diameter 21.6 mm (over ribs)
Maximum active section length 1800 m
Minimum breaking strength 22 kN
Maximum allowable working load 4.5 kN
Point (local) pressure loading 10 Mpa
Minimum sheave diameter 1.5 m
Weight in air 564 kg/km
Weight in sea water 210 kg/km
Maximum operating depth 100m

SeaRay® 300
Color yellow
Outside diameter 28.5 mm (over ribs)
Maximum active section length 1800 m
Minimum breaking strength 66 kN
Maximum allowable working load 16.5 kN
Point (local) pressure loading 10 Mpa
Minimum sheave diameter 3.0 m
Weight in air 849 kg/km
Weight in sea water 231 kg/km
Maximum operating depth 300m
500m (with specific handling care)

OPTICAL EXTENDER
Construction Double armour
Outside diameter 23.0 mm
Maximum length 2,4 kms
Minimum breaking strength 300 kN
Maximum allowable working load 80 kN
Minimum sheave diameter 3m
Weight in air 1700 kg/km
Weight in sea water 1350 kg/km
Maximum operating depth 300m
500m (with specific handling care)
SENSORS
AQDSU

GENERAL
Sensor Component 3 omni tilt digital
accelerometer and 1
hydrophone
Sample rates** 4,2,1,0.5,0.25 ms
Word Size 24 bits
Offset 0 (digitally zeroed)
High cut filter** 0.8 FN (linear or minimum phase)
Stop band attenuation > 120 dB (above Nyquist)
Time Standard True synchronous system
Phase accuracy 20 μs
Power consumption Typical (during acquisition): 320mW
Max (during sensor tests): 370mW

DIGITAL ACCELEROMETER CHANNELS


Type Omni tilt DSU-428
Full scale 5m/s2
Tilt Max Value ± 180°
Bandwidth 0 – 400 Hz (up to 1600 Hz with degraded specifications)
Distortion -90 dB
Amplitude Calibration Accuracy ± 0.25%
Orthogonality Calibration Accuracy ± 0.25°
Noise (10-200Hz) 0.4 μm/s2/√Hz
System dynamic range 120 dB @ 4 ms
Tilt accuracy ± 0.5° @ 20°C

HYDROPHONE CHANNEL
Type FDU-428 Input with
charge amplifier
Full scale @ G1600: 1.6 V RMS
@ G400: 400 mV RMS
Noise (3-200Hz) (typical) @ G1600: 450 nV RMS
@ G400: 145 nV RMS
Bandwidth 3 – 1600 Hz
Instant dynamic range 124 dB
System dynamic range 136 dB
Distortion -110 dB
CMRR 110 dB
Gain Accuracy <0.1%
Phase Accuracy 20 μs

CANISTER
Material Nickel aluminium
Bronze
Outside diameter of canister 54 mm
Length: overall length of canister 203.2 mm
length over non-mated connectors 240.1 mm
length over mated connectors 300.4 mm
Weight in air 1.571 kg

** Bandwidth limited to 400Hz with full specification


SSH HYDROPHONE
All specifications apply at ambient pressure and 20ºC. All electrical and acoustic measurements are made with the two internal hydrophone
elements combined into an in-phase, parallel circuit. All sensitivity values are free-field voltage sensitivity (FFVS). All specifications without
tolerance limits denote typical values.

GENERAL
Material polyurethane sleeve
Fill fluid Silicone fluid
Outside diameter of cylinder 54 mm
Length 154 mm
Weight in air 0.405 kg
Operating temperature –15ºC to +50ºC
Storage temperature –40ºC to +60ºC

ELECTRICAL SPECIFICATION
Lead type 4-conductor cable with an Impulse 4pin 90-degree connector
Lead length 140 mm
Capacitance 9.6 nF ±15% at 1 V & 1 KHz (@ 20ºC & 1 ATM)
(Approx. 0.4% increase per degree C°).
9.6 nF stands for the equivalent capacitance of the two hydrophone elements in parallel connection. The
system’s sensor test reads the average of the capacitance values of the two elements, that is 4.8 nF.
Resistance, lead to lead or lead to case > 100 MΩ @ 10 VDC.
Dissipation factor 0.02 (typical maximum)

PERFORMANCE SPECIFICATION
Voltage sensitivity Hydrophone sensitivity:
–204.5 dB re 1 V/μPa (5.96 V/bar) ± 1.5 dB at 20 Hz (@ 20ºC & 1 ATM).
System sensitivity (including charge amplifier): 5.66 V/bar.
Voltage sensitivity vs. temperature <1.5 dB change from –10ºC to +40ºC (0.04 dB maximum change per 1ºC)
Maximum operating depth 500 m
